Robin Maria Pedrero, a fine artist living in Orlando, Florida states clearly and simply in her blog profile, "I must create. That's all there is to it." Her beautiful etsy shop contains her original paintings, ACEOs, prints and accessories that include bags and mugs.
Pedrero is listed in Florida International Magazine’s 2009 Florida Artists Hall of Fame and is an elected signature member of the Pastel Society of America. Her artwork will be featured in the upcoming 2011 thriller movie “Roommates."

She uses charcoal, pastel, colored pencil, ink and acrylic or oil paint on various papers, wood, or canvas in her work. Her colorful art manages to be vibrant and serene, natural and abstract and luminous and intense all at the same time.

This week's ETT SOTW (Etsy Twitter Team Shop of the Week) is frosted treats, featuring the creations of Jessica Mount. Since 2008, Jessica has used polymer clay to create delicious looking charms in the shape of cupcakes, cakes, cookies and flowers. The shops' products also include general accessories such as bookmarks, push pins and magnets.


Jessica says "Since clay is my medium, the possibilities of what I can create are only limited by my own imagination. That is why I LOVE custom orders. I love having someone ask for something abstract and being able to say, "Yup! I can do that!"

In addition to her Etsy shop, Jessica will be showing her creations at craft fairs and markets this holiday season. She's been sketching out some ideas for new holiday ornaments and gifts to carry in her etsy shop.

Our new ETT SOTW is in my head studios featuring altered mixed-media domino and game piece jewelry, microscope slide glass pendants and ACEOs (Art Cards Editions and Originals) by Vickie Porter.
In describing her work, Vickie admits, "I have a seriously good/bad relationship with perfectionism so my customers can rest assured they are getting top quality materials and artwork. It’s sometimes hard to tell in photos online, but the dominoes and microscope slide glass pendants have real tiny paper collages on them. I work with ridiculously small pieces of paper sometimes.

For her beautiful and intricate creations, Vickie gets her inspiration from colors, lines, and shapes. "I simply have to create or I’m not happy. It’s like needing air." It follows that Vickie is not confined by rules, but lets her inspiration and creativity run wild and while she may not stick to one medium, she admits, "Central to almost everything I do is paper. I love paper."

Vickie is happy to take custom orders and ships internationally.

The new ETT SOTW is Most Favorite Aunt (aka Pamela Ziemlewicz). The shop is full of “knits and flair,” from baby hats, coffee cup cozies and other knitted goods to pinback buttons—all adorable, all handmade, and “all me,” says Pamela. Don't you wish you had an aunt who could make things like these?

Her inspiration? “I'm pretty sassy. Usually I'll make some smart-alec remark and then think, ‘Oooh, that would make a cool...’” Her motivation? “I work a lot. At the end of a long day, I love turning on the boob-tube, and sitting down with some yarn and needles to relax.” She’d like to turn her craft into a full-time endeavor and dreams of quitting her day job…maybe by 2011!
Her upcoming plans? “Fall and Winter are always BIG seasons for me. Lots of people buying warm fuzzies. Lots of cold and yucky days to spend inside creating.” Look for an increased and ever-changing inventory!
